Familial exudative vitreoretinopathy
Albrecht von Graefes Archiv f�r Klinische und Experimentelle Ophthalmologie, 1980A pedigree of familial exudative vitreoretinopathy is presented; 12 out of 37 family members examined were affected and the inheritance pattern was compatible with an autosomal dominant disease. Clinical findings and fluorescein angiographic studies of patients with the early stages of the disease support the concept that familial exudative ...

A sliver is a tetrahedon whose four vertices lie close to a plane and whose orthogonal projection to that plane is a convex quadrilateral with no short edge. Slivers are notoriously common in 3-dimensional Delaunay triangulations even for well-spaced point sets.
